Pcb assembly is the following major step, where components are mounted onto the fabricated board. This is likewise called pcb assembly manufacturing or pcba manufacturing, and it transforms the bare board into a practical electronic assembly. Surface mount technology, or smt assembly, is the most typical technique, though through-hole components still appear in lots of layouts. A pcba, meaning printed circuit card assembly, consists of the board plus all soldered parts. In functional terms, pcba vs pcb is simple: the pcb is the bare board, while the pcba is the ended up board with components mounted. Modern boards count on many interconnect technologies, including pcb via, microvia, blind via, buried via, and blind and buried vias. HDI printed circuit boards frequently use microvias and fine lines to support thick component layouts such as bga pcb assembly. Because of the boosting demands for smaller products, hd i board and high density pcb manufacturing proceed to expand throughout customer, medical, aerospace pcb, and protection applications.
Rigid pcb is the standard format used in most devices, while flexible pcb, flex pcb, flexible printed circuit board, and flex circuits permit the board to fold up or bend. Rigid flex pcb and rigid flex circuit styles combine rigid and flexible areas into one assembly, which conserves space and improves dependability in systems that require motion or intricate kind factors.
